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- In Q4, the company achieved revenue of $306 million, up 9% year-over-year or 8% in constant currency, and Q4 EPS of $0.49, exceeding guidance [6][23] - For fiscal 2026, total revenue reached $1.18 billion, an 8% increase year-over-year, with operating margins at 28% [6][22] - The company generated record free cash flow of $313 million, up 3% year-over-year [22][26] - Q4 gross margin was 82.3%, exceeding guidance of 82%, representing an increase of 130 basis points year-over-year [26]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Enterprise Advanced customers now account for 10% of total revenue, reflecting strong early traction [7][24] - Customers paying at least $100,000 annually grew by 9% year-over-year [23] - Total Suites customers now represent 66% of revenue, up from 60% a year ago [24]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Approximately 40% of revenue is generated outside the U.S., with 65% of this international revenue coming from Japan [28] - The company expects Q1 revenue to be approximately $304 million, representing about 10% year-over-year growth [28]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on enhancing its intelligent content management platform with AI capabilities, aiming to drive automation in enterprise workflows [12][21] - Strategic investments will continue in key growth verticals and partnerships to capture market opportunities [20][31] - The company plans to deliver next-generation AI agent features and advanced workflow automation capabilities in FY27 [15][16]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the growth of enterprise content and the role it plays in AI strategies, anticipating a significant increase in unstructured data [11][21] - The company is optimistic about the momentum seen with Enterprise Advanced and expects it to drive growth in the coming years [43][44] - Management noted that the macro environment and AI advancements are critical to the company's future performance [3][21] Other Important Information - The company repurchased approximately 9.7 million shares for about $293 million in FY26, representing over 90% of free cash flow generation [27] - The company expects FY27 gross margin to be approximately 81.5% and operating margin to be around 28% [30][31] Q&A Session Summary Question: What is the opportunity from AI and its impact on the content layer? - Management is excited about the role of content in agentic systems and expects a rise in software generated through AI, which will require secure storage for unstructured data [34][35][36] Question: What are the expectations for Enterprise Advanced in fiscal 2027? - Management anticipates continued growth from Enterprise Advanced, with pricing uplifts of 30%-40% expected to persist [42][44] Question: How is AI adoption progressing in regulated industries? - Management noted a healthy adoption of applied AI use cases in regulated industries, with a focus on data extraction and workflow automation [50][52] Question: Can you elaborate on the Q1 billings guidance and FX headwinds? - Management explained that the significant FX headwind in Q1 is due to prior year exchange rate movements, with an expected normalized impact for the year [53][56] Question: What is the outlook for net revenue retention? - Management expects net revenue retention to improve modestly, driven by pricing uplifts and net seat expansion [70][72] Question: How do you view the evolution of Enterprise Advanced customer adoption? - Management indicated that most Enterprise Advanced customers are upgrades from existing customers, with significant opportunities remaining for non-Enterprise Plus customers [84][86]

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- In Q3, the company reported revenue of $301 million, representing a 9% year-over-year growth, exceeding guidance [21][22] - Operating margin was 28.6%, with gross margin at 81.7%, both metrics surpassing expectations [23][24] - Net retention rate improved to 104%, up from 103% in Q2 and 102% year-over-year, driven by strong demand for Box AI [23][29]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Billings grew by 12% year-over-year to $296 million, exceeding guidance of approximately 10% [22][23] - Remaining performance obligations (RPO) reached $1.5 billion, growing 18% year-over-year, indicating strong customer demand [22][23]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company noted that approximately one-third of revenue is generated outside the U.S., with 65% of international revenue coming from Japan [25] - The company is experiencing strong momentum in the federal sector, particularly after receiving FedRAMP High authorization [43]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focusing on driving adoption of its AI-powered solutions, particularly through the Enterprise Advanced platform [16][29] - Strategic partnerships with major firms like AWS and Tata Consultancy Services are aimed at enhancing AI capabilities and expanding market reach [14][18] - The company is committed to becoming a leading AI-first organization, leveraging AI agents to improve productivity and customer service [20][29]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the ongoing demand for Box AI and the potential for continued growth in net retention rates and seat expansions [46][60] - The company anticipates Q4 revenue to be approximately $304 million, with full-year revenue expected to reach $1.175 billion, reflecting an 8% year-over-year growth [26][27] Other Important Information - The company repurchased 2.4 million shares for approximately $77 million in Q3, with an additional $150 million authorized for share repurchase [24][25] - The company plans to settle $205 million of convertible notes due in January 2026 with cash [25] Q&A Session Summary Question: Insights on growth levers since March Analyst Day - Management indicated that growth levers are tracking well, with strong adoption of Enterprise Advanced and AI capabilities exceeding expectations [32][34] Question: Drivers of sales and marketing efficiency - Management noted improvements in sales productivity and emphasized ongoing investments in sales capacity and partnerships [37][39] Question: Update on FedRAMP High and federal vertical performance - Management confirmed positive momentum in federal sales, despite some deal timing shifts due to the government shutdown [42][43] Question: Impact of macro recovery on seat growth - Management acknowledged a macroeconomic element but emphasized that seat expansions are primarily driven by new use cases enabled by AI capabilities [44][46] Question: Competitive landscape and AI's impact on content management - Management highlighted that AI is expanding the content management market and driving migrations from legacy systems to Box [49][55] Question: Insights on Enterprise Advanced and seat growth - Management noted continued strength in both pricing and seat growth, indicating significant upside potential for net retention rates [59][60] Question: Go-to-market investment priorities - Management outlined a focus on verticalization, partner ecosystems, and scaling high ROI marketing programs as key investment areas [75][76]
